Two Fables, One Review

It’s been a good few weeks to be a fan of Bill Willingham’s storybook send-up Fables. Not only did the series finally get the Deluxe Edition treatment (well, the first ten issues did anyway), but Willingham and frequent series contributor Steve Leialoha put together the first-ever prose novel based in the Fables universe. SDCC 09: The JSA No More?

Big news for the Justice Society of America comes from Comic-Con's DC JSA: The Great Society panel. This full panel including such names as Bill Willingham, Matthew Sturges, Freddie Williams and Mike Carlin shifted focus away from Geoff John's impressive run, and instead shifted it to the future of the series – which isn't all that far off, as Willingham and Sturges's run hits stands next week....
